    ZZ383 Swap into a C2

    I have just completed a ZZ383 swap into my 66 Coupe with a small block hood. Everything fit just fine and the hood WILL close. We had to use a Patriot D port header that fit nicely. Used an Edelbrock Performer Vortec manifold, Holley Street Avenger 750, stock 66 drop base air filter with a 3"x14" Fram filter. Hood closes with no problem.

    Re: ZZ383 Swap into a C2

    Are you going to race or just pleasure drive your 66? I put a ZZ1 crate engine in my 70 coupe and have really enjoyed the increased performance. I used the original exhaust manifolds although they were not a exact match for the D-port aluminum head ports. For the type of pleasure driving I don't think the difference is all that great. My crate engine came with a LT-1 style alumimun high rise intake and using the drop type open element air cleaner my hood closed clearance is just fine. What is the performance like with your 383?

      Re: ZZ383 Swap into a C2

      The performance of the 383 is outstanding. I do not plan on any "racing" the car just street and highway driving. I chose the 383 for it's high HP/Torque rating in a small block. My concern was to get it under a small block hood which I did. I went with headers on mine because when I took a new set of 2.5" rams horns to be port matched to the D port heads they did not feel there would be enough material left to get a good seal wiht a header gasket.
